Frozen water line repair services focus on fixing pipes that have become damaged or burst due to freezing temperatures. When outdoor or exposed indoor pipes freeze, the water inside expands, which can cause the pipe material to crack or break. Service providers specializing in this area work to identify the affected sections, thaw frozen pipes safely, and replace or repair damaged pipe segments. Addressing frozen water lines promptly helps prevent further damage to plumbing systems and reduces the risk of costly water leaks or flooding inside the property.
This service is essential for resolving common issues caused by freezing conditions, such as low water pressure, no water flow, or visible leaks from burst pipes. Properties that typically require frozen water line repair include residential homes, especially those with outdoor spigots, unheated basements, or crawl spaces. Homes located in areas with harsh winter weather are more prone to frozen pipes. Additionally, seasonal properties or vacation homes that are not regularly heated may experience freezing issues. Commercial buildings, small businesses, and rental properties with exposed or poorly insulated plumbing are also at risk. Minor Repairs - For small fixes like thawing frozen pipes or sealing leaks,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the specific issue and accessibility.
Moderate Repairs - When replacing sections of damaged water lines or addressing multiple frozen areas, costs generally range from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common and often involve more extensive work but remain manageable for most homeowners.
Full Water Line Replacement - Complete replacement of frozen or burst water lines can cost from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, especially for larger or complex systems. Larger, more involved projects tend to push into the higher end of this range.
Emergency or Complex Jobs - Severe damage or urgent repairs, such as extensive pipe bursts or underground line replacements, can exceed $5,000. These cases are less frequent but require specialized services from experienced local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a frozen water line? A frozen water line typically results from low outdoor temperatures combined with insufficient insulation or exposure to cold air, which can cause the water inside the pipe to freeze and block flow.
How can I tell if my water line is frozen? Signs of a frozen water line include no water flow from fixtures, a visible frost or ice on the pipe, or a pipe that feels cold to the touch in the affected area.
What are the risks of ignoring a frozen water line? Ignoring a frozen water line can lead to pipe bursts, water damage, and costly repairs once the ice thaws and the pipe breaks.
What services do local contractors offer for frozen water line repair? Local service providers can thaw frozen pipes, repair or replace damaged sections, and help prevent future freezing issues through insulation and other solutions.
How can I prevent my water lines from freezing in the future? Preventative measures include insulating exposed pipes, sealing drafts around pipes, and maintaining consistent indoor temperatures during cold weather.
